  • Caring for Trees

    St. Peter’s Anglican Church 4333 Bath Road, Kingston

    Janssens Orchards is a 34-acre family farm business with a focus on growing heritage fruit trees --apples, pears, plums and cherries. Mike Janssen, owner, will share his farm's holistic approach in caring for trees, and explain the ecological growing practices used to promote tree health, foster biodiversity and reduce impact on the natural environment.
